India is reeling under a fresh surge of COVID-19 cases and with 1 lakh cases recorded in a day, the situation has become alarming. Experts are of the belief that this time the virus is showing different symptoms. The second wave of coronavirus is spreading at a rapid scale, infecting even healthier people. 

Earlier, the symptoms of novel coronavirus were fever, dry cough, and tiredness. However, this time around doctors are witnessing uncommon symptoms, which can be called new COVID-19 symptoms. Several studies have suggested that pink eyes, gastronomical conditions, and hearing impairment are the new symptoms and it should not be taken lightly.

New COVID-19 symptoms

According to doctors in Gujarat, 40% of COVID-19 patients visited them with a complaint of diarrhea, body pain, stomach pain, and vomiting. 

A study done in China has revealed that pink eye or conjunctivitis is a sign of COVID-19 infection. People can develop redness, swelling and the eye becomes watery. 12 people who got infected with a new strain showed this symptom.

If you have observed ringing sound or some kind of hearing impairment in the recent past, then that could be a sign of COVID-19. A study published in the International Journal of Audiology said that the COVID-19 infection can lead to auditory problems. 

The researchers found 56 studies that identified an association between COVID-19 and auditory and vestibular problems. They pooled data from 24 of the studies to estimate that the prevalence of hearing loss was 7.6%.

As per doctors, many gastrointestinal complaints are also coming in. A new study says that diarrhea, vomiting, abdominal cramps, nausea, and pain are signs of coronavirus. If you are facing any digestive discomfort, you must get yourself tested.

COVID-19 cases in India

India detected 115,736 new COVID-19 cases on Tuesday, the highest daily increase so far. 

Nearly 55,000 cases were reported in Maharashtra, while Chhattisgarh scaled a new peak of 9,921 cases.

Karnataka, Uttar Pradesh, and Delhi reported more than 5,000 cases each.
